export interface SelectMenuData {
/**
* Determines where the dialog with the menu will show relative to
* the show button.
* Defaults to Bottom.
*/
position: Dialogs.Dialog.DialogVerticalPosition;
/**
* Determines where the dialog with the menu will show horizontally
* relative to the show button.
* Defaults to Auto
*/
horizontalAlignment: Dialogs.Dialog.DialogHorizontalAlignment;
/**
* The title of the menu button. Can be either a string or a function
* that returns a LitHTML template.
* If not set, the title of the button will default to the selected
* item's text.
*/
buttonTitle: string|TitleCallback;
/**
* Determines if an arrow, pointing to the opposite side of
* the dialog, is shown at the end of the button. If
* showconnector is set to true the arrow is always shown.
* Defaults to false.
*/
showArrow: boolean;
/**
* Determines if the component is formed by two buttons:
* one to open the meny and another that triggers a
* selectmenusidebuttonclickEvent. The RecordMenu instance of
* the component is an example of this use case.
* Defaults to false.
*/
sideButton: boolean;
/**
* Determines if a connector from the dialog to the button
* is shown.
* Defaults to false.
*/
showConnector: boolean;
/**
* Whether the menu button is disabled.
* Defaults to false.
*/
disabled: boolean;
/**
* Determines if dividing lines between the menu's options
* are shown.
*/
showDivider: boolean;
/**
* Determines if the selected item is marked using a checkmark.
* Defaults to true.
*/
showSelectedItem: boolean;
}
type TitleCallback = () => LitHtml.TemplateResult;
